What is Hunteria Umbellata?
Hunteria Umbellata, known regionally as "Erin," is the seed of Hunteria umbellata, a tree in the dogbane family (Apocynaceae) native to the forests of West Africa, particularly Nigeria, Ghana, and surrounding regions.
About the plant
The tree grows in the lowland rainforests of West Africa, where its seeds have a long history in regional folk tradition. It is comparatively uncommon on the Western botanical market.
